What Is the ABB AI815 Analog Input Module?
Struggling with signal accuracy and transmitter integration in your process control system? The ABB AI815 Analog Input Module delivers a reliable solution for demanding industrial environments. This 8-channel module accepts unipolar single-ended inputs for 0...20 mA, 4...20 mA, 0...5 V, or 1...5 V d.c. signals. It features built-in HART pass-through communication, enabling seamless integration with smart transmitters. The AI815 belongs to the ABB S800 I/O family, ensuring compatibility with ABB control systems.
Technical Specifications Breakdown
The AI815 provides 12-bit resolution for precise measurement. Input impedance is greater than 10 MΩ for voltage inputs and 250 Ω for current inputs. The module offers groupwise isolation from ground for one group of eight channels. It withstands overvoltage or undervoltage of at least 11 V d.c. Key performance specs include a maximum error of 0.1%, temperature drift of 50 ppm/°C, and an update cycle time of 10 ms. The input filter has a rise time of 0-90% at 290 ms. Power dissipation is 3.5 W, with current consumption of 100 mA on the +5 V Modulebus and 50 mA on the +24 V Modulebus. External +24 V consumption reaches a maximum of 265 mA. The module supports HART pass-through and includes a current-limited transmitter supply per channel.

Installation and Setup Guidance
Mount the AI815 on a suitable S800 mounting terminal unit (MTU) such as TU810, TU812, TU814, TU830, TU833, TU835, or TU838. Ensure the module is properly keyed with code CC. Connect field wiring to the MTU terminals, respecting polarity for current inputs. For voltage inputs, use shielded cables to reduce noise. The maximum field cable length is 600 meters (656 yards). Do not mix voltage and current signals on the same module. Verify the external power supply is HART compatible if used for feeding HART transmitters.
Maintenance and Reliability
The AI815 includes front LEDs for fault (F), run (R), and warning (W) status. Supervision monitors module errors such as analog readback, reference voltage, internal power supply, checksum, watchdog, and memory errors. External channel errors detect low external power supply or transmitter power issues. Operate the module within 0 to +55 °C (+32 to +131 °F) for standard use, and store between -40 to +70 °C (-40 to +158 °F). The IP20 protection class suits clean indoor environments. Compatibility and Integration
The AI815 integrates with ABB control systems via the S800 I/O bus. It works with MTUs like TU810V1 and other listed models. The module supports HART pass-through communication, allowing configuration tools to access smart field devices. For redundancy or high-integrity applications, note that this module does not support redundancy or high integrity configurations. Frequently Asked Questions
Can the AI815 handle both voltage and current inputs simultaneously?
No, the module cannot mix voltage and current signals on the same I/O module. You must configure all channels for either voltage or current input.
What is the maximum cable length for field wiring?
The maximum field cable length is 600 meters (656 yards). Use appropriate cable types to maintain signal integrity.
Does the AI815 support HART communication?
Yes, the module includes HART pass-through communication, enabling digital communication with HART-compatible transmitters.
What is the resolution of the AI815?
The module provides 12-bit resolution, offering adequate precision for most process control applications.
What certifications does the AI815 hold?
It carries CE mark, electrical safety certifications per EN 61010-1 and UL 61010-1, hazardous location approvals (C1 Div 2, C1 Zone 2, ATEX Zone 2), and marine certifications from BV, DNV, and LR.
